#ffb543 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ffb543 is composed of 100% red, 71%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 29% magenta, 73.7%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 36.4 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 63.1%. #ffb543 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ff86 with #ff6b00.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c33.

Shades and Tints of #ffb543

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080500 is the darkest color, while #fffaf4 is the lightest one.
